About N-[(2-bromo-5-chlorophenyl)methyl]-1-[4-(1,2,4-triazol-1-yl)phenyl]methanamine
N-[(2-bromo-5-chlorophenyl)methyl]-1-[4-(1,2,4-triazol-1-yl)phenyl]methanamine (PubChem CID 75422844) has the molecular formula C16H14BrClN4
and a molecular weight of 377.67 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is N-[(2-bromo-5-chlorophenyl)methyl]-1-[4-(1,2,4-triazol-1-yl)phenyl]methanamine.

What is the SMILES notation for N-[(2-bromo-5-chlorophenyl)methyl]-1-[4-(1,2,4-triazol-1-yl)phenyl]methanamine?
The canonical SMILES for N-[(2-bromo-5-chlorophenyl)methyl]-1-[4-(1,2,4-triazol-1-yl)phenyl]methanamine is Clc1ccc(Br)c(CNCc2ccc(-n3cncn3)cc2)c1.
What is the InChIKey of N-[(2-bromo-5-chlorophenyl)methyl]-1-[4-(1,2,4-triazol-1-yl)phenyl]methanamine?
The InChIKey is JRLJKWRRGKTNAB-UHFFFAOYS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C16H14BrClN4/c17-16-6-3-14(18)7-13(16)9-19-8-12-1-4-15(5-2-12)22-11-20-10-21-22/h1-7,10-11,19H,8-9H2.
What are the key properties of N-[(2-bromo-5-chlorophenyl)methyl]-1-[4-(1,2,4-triazol-1-yl)phenyl]methanamine?
N-[(2-bromo-5-chlorophenyl)methyl]-1-[4-(1,2,4-triazol-1-yl)phenyl]methanamine has a molecular weight of 377.67 g/mol, XLogP of 3.97, 5 rotatable bonds, 1 hydrogen bond donors, and 4 hydrogen bond acceptors.
